The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services’ (HHS) Office for Civil Rights (OCR) recently issued guidance regarding the application of HIPAA to requests for information about COVID-19 vaccines. Specifically, the guidance reminds us that HIPPA applies only to HIPPA covered entities, such as health plans, health care clearinghouses, and health care providers that conduct standard electronic transactions (and in some cases, their business associates), not employers or employment records. The guidance goes further to address common workplace scenarios and answer frequently asked questions.
“We are issuing this guidance to help consumers, businesses, and health care entities understand when HIPAA applies to disclosures about COVID-19 vaccination status and to ensure that they have the information they need to make informed decisions about protecting themselves and others from COVID-19,” said OCR Director Lisa Pino.
